Schedule A1, Part VI, paragraph 141(4)
TULRCA 1992
Trade Union and Labour Relations (Consolidation) Act 1992 · United Kingdom
If the CAC decides that the application is not admissible— the CAC must give notice of its decision to the worker (or workers), the employer and the union (or unions), the CAC must not accept the application, and no further steps are to be taken under this Part of this Schedule.
